I was thinking 10ish like last time?  I'm pretty flexible though. 

Actually, there is also a full loop that goes Aspen Grove to Morrison (via c-470 trail) then to BCT and back to Sant Fe trail, but it's 35ish miles - usually a good 2 hour ride...  It's pretty flat - if you ride it one way there is one, short steeper hill, and the other way, there is a longer more gradual hill (and windy uphill usually...) but it's almost ALL on the trails and with a bigger group, it gets a little tight on those bike trails.
